Filaret (Drozdov Vasily Mikhailovich, Metropolitan of Moscow and Kolomna, 1783-1867).
The word spoken in the presence of their imperial highnesses of the princes of the Grand Dukes Nikolai Pavlovich and Mikhail Pavlovich, under the coffin of the commander-in-chief of the General Feldmarshal's armies, all Russian orders of the first degree of the cavalier, St. John of Jerusalem, the large cross of the commander, the most brilliant prince Mikhail Ilarionovich Golenishchev-Kutuzov of Smolensk the day of his burial, June 13, 1813, in the Kazan Cathedral, the St. Petersburg Theological Academy rector, Archimandrite Filaret. - In St. Petersburg: At the Most Holy Synod, [1813]. - [2], 31, [1] p. ; 8 ° (21 cm). -
